Excessive on the hog in Donegal

Muckish is a flat-topped mountain to the north of Glenveagh nationwide park. {Photograph}: Steven Granville/Getty Pictures

For mountain surroundings with out Alpine crowds, head to north-west Donegal. Errigal will get the eye, however don’t overlook flat-topped Muckish, whose title comes from the Irish for “pig’s again”. Drive the small roads across the Poisoned Glen and thru Glenveagh nationwide park, the place every bend reveals another excuse to cease. Permit far longer than the satnav suggests: our greatest moments got here from pulling over for an surprising view fairly than racing between sights. Pack strolling footwear and a picnic, then reward your self afterwards in a comfortable pub. Right here, a mountain day can embrace Atlantic seashores and a well-earned pint.

The quiet facet of Italy’s Dolomites

Alpine hut Rifugio Agostini was the spotlight of Ben Bryant’s journey. {Photograph}: Johannes 86/Getty Pictures

The Brenta Dolomites appear to go unusually unnoticed, whereas the principle Dolomites heave with Instagrammers. We based mostly ourselves in Pinzolo, an alpine city an hour north of Lake Garda, then took the raise from Madonna di Campiglio for a three-day hut-to-hut trek, tackling two through ferrata routes throughout knife-edge ridges and limestone spires. Rifugio Agostini was the spotlight: a heat welcome and hearty mountain meals after a tough day’s climbing, with jagged peaks filling each window. We descended into the city of Molveno for a well-earned aperitivo by the lake.

A spectacular climb in Kosovo

The Lumbardhi River in Prizren. {Photograph}: Engin Korkmaz/Alamy

After exploring Kosovo’s historic monasteries and wartime memorials, we escaped to the Sharr mountains nationwide park, a 40-minute drive south of Prizren. The highway winds via the spectacular Zhupa valley and follows the effervescent Lumbardhi river via its steep-sided gorge. At Prevallë, we left the automotive and started what turned out to be a strenuous climb over rocky paths and grassy slopes. We saved anticipating the summit to look, however each flip revealed one other, till we lastly reached our vacation spot and have been met with spectacular mountain views. Afterwards, we rewarded ourselves at Lodge Krojet with espresso and a reviving glass of raki.

Peaceable paths above Lake Como

The Through dei Monti Lariani passes near Mount Bregagno.
{Photograph}: Mauritius/Alamy

This spring, my companion and I hiked the Through dei Monti Lariani, a 78-mile (125km) path via the mountains on the western shore of Lake Como between Cernobbio and Sorico. Skirting the border between Italy and the Swiss canton of Ticino, the route passes via mountain pastures with views in the direction of the Alps, and distant villages formed by a historical past of cross-border smuggling. The lodging is a spotlight, starting from Alpine rifugios to agriturismi, the place we sampled regional specialities, together with polenta uncia, polenta with native cheese and butter, and pizzoccheri, buckwheat pasta with cabbage and potatoes. Quiet trails, wonderful meals and complicated historical past made it an particularly rewarding route.
